Capacitorless Model of a VO2 Oscillator | M. A. Belyaev
; A. A. Velichko
; | Date: |
16 Nov 2019 | Abstract: | We implement a capacitorless model of a VO2 oscillator by introducing into
the circuit of a field-effect transistor and a VO2 thermal sensor, which
provide negative current feedback with a time delay. We compare the dynamics of
current and voltage oscillations on a switch in a circuit with a capacitor and
without a capacitor. The oscillation period in the capacitorless model is
controlled in a narrow range by changing the distance between the switch and
the sensor. The capacitorless model provides the possibility of significant
miniaturization of the oscillator circuit, and it is important for the
implementation of large arrays of oscillators in oscillatory neural networks to
solve the problem of classification and pattern recognition. | Source: | arXiv, 1911.6983 | Services: | Forum | Review | PDF | Favorites |
